From Dazed Digital: Photographing people in “varying states of sobriety”, Morgan O’Donovan took over 500 portraits of the faces gracing East-London haunts. The series feature revellers approached over 12 nights in late 2009, and the subjects were captured on-the-moment in whatever state he found them in.

Though atypical of nightlife photography, each photo is shot using the harsh exposure of a medical photography flash. Faces appear tightly cropped dominating most of the frame drawing the viewer to acute similarities and difference between faces. (Read full article HERE). Exhibition opened on Wednesday at Dalston Superstore in London.

Exhibition Noughtie Nightlife takes place in London until 2nd October. The project focuses on the fashion, faces and attitudes of cult London club nights and celebrates the first decade of the new century through the images that tell the story, taken by the photographers who were there. The exhibition provides both a recent retrospective and a contemporary archive of 21st century youth culture and style portraits, focusing on the influence of music and clubbing on fashion and vice versa. Noughtie Nightlife, an London College of Fashion research funded project, demonstrates the power and importance of nightlife club photography as a medium in itself, documenting youth culture, style and attitude.
